Before COVID shut the library down, I was helping a little boy and his mom find books.
“What do you like to read about?” I asked. “Dinosaurs!” This is common request, but can mean different things, “Okay. Do you want a story about dinosaurs, or facts about dinosaurs?” “Facts.” I took him to the dinosaur section (567.9) of the juvenile nonfiction. He picked out a couple books, and I asked him if there was anything else he was looking for. “Do you have anything on DNA?” I had to think about that for a second. “I think so…but I’ll have to look it up.” The boy beamed, “I want to find out how DNA works, so I can bring them back!” “We just saw Jurassic Park,” his mom explained with a smile that did not waver when she added, “We didn’t learn anything.”

If the writer’s strike fucks up your favorite show, then it is working as intended.
the point of a strike is twofold. the first is to cost the company money. the second (which is an extension of the first) is to inconvenience you, the consumer. why?
so that you complain to the company. so that the company gets tweet after post after email after call after letter saying that you want your show back, and if the company doesn’t agree to the WGA’s terms then you’re cancelling your subscription.
so, again:
your show being delayed or cancelled is not an unfortunate side effect of the writer’s strike. it is the entire point. support the writers.
